The team behind the 80ft Trimaran LoveWater were already champions in our minds when they joined hands with the WWF to raise awareness of plastic pollution in our oceans. But they also smashed the trans-Atlantic record in the Cape to Rio Race by some 3 days. Behind their record attempt is their love for the ocean along with their goal to raise awareness surrounding the devastation that plastic has had on our environment.

British-South African Lewis Pugh has been a pioneer in long-distance swimming for close to 30 years. He was the first person to complete a long-distance swim in every ocean of the world, his most well-known expedition being the first-ever attempt to swim across the North Pole in 2007. This effort was to highlight the melting of the Arctic Ocean ice. His latest endeavour was to swim down a river under the Antarctic ice sheet to call for greater protection around the continent.
